Core Viewpoint - Haining City in Zhejiang Province is implementing the development philosophy of "Lucid waters and lush mountains are invaluable assets," focusing on the integration of ecological and economic development through the exploration of the "Two Mountains" transformation path [1][2]. Group 1: Ecological and Economic Integration - The city is prioritizing ecological development and green growth by scientifically developing the Qiantang River International Tourism Corridor while balancing industrial relocation and the protection of century-old trees [1]. - Initiatives include promoting green transformation in social production and life, fostering "waste-free villages" and "waste-free enterprises," and implementing collaborative pollution reduction and carbon reduction governance [1][2]. - Efforts are being made to improve air quality through industrial emissions control, banning straw burning, and enhancing river management and biodiversity restoration [1]. Group 2: Ecological Product Value Realization - Haining is pioneering the accounting of Gross Ecosystem Product (GEP) and exploring mechanisms for realizing the value of ecological products [2]. - The development of unique cultural tourism projects leveraging the natural endowment of the Qiantang River has led to the creation of an "ecology + tidal culture" themed IP [2]. - The "Ecological Pavilion + Café" model has gained popularity on social media, and local agricultural products are being enhanced in value, with successful examples being recognized nationally [2]. Group 3: Future-Oriented Ecological Governance - The city is focusing on modernizing the ecological governance system by implementing the "One Line Green" indicator evaluation system, which addresses blue skies, clear waters, clean land, and ecological civilization [2]. - Village-level ecological initiatives are being established, with activities planned around the "Sixth Environment Day" to promote the "Two Mountains" philosophy and ignite community engagement in ecological transformation [2].
